Mario Gabriele Andretti was born February 28, 1940. He would grow up to be one of the most successful Americans in the history of the sport. He is one of only two drivers to win races in Formula One, IndyCar, World Sportscar Championship and NASCAR (the other being Dan Gurney).

Eric Bryan Lindros was born February 28, 1973. He would become a 7-time NHL All-Star with the Philadelphia Flyers, New York Rangers, Toronto Maple Leafs, and Dallas Stars. He won the Hart Trophy in 1995. He is the 6th faster player ever to 600 points.

Tayshaun Durell Prince was born February 28, 1980. He was a great player for the University of Kentucy, and has had a great NBA career. He still plays for the Detroit Pistons, where he won a championship in 2004.
